Biography of Dwayne Johnson

DetailInformation
NameDwayne Douglas Johnson
Date of BirthMay 2, 1972
Place of BirthHayward, California, USA
Height6 ft 5 in (196 cm)
ProfessionActor, Producer, Former Professional Wrestler

Early Life and Career

Dwayne Johnson was born into a family of wrestlers, with his father, Rocky Johnson, and grandfather, Peter Maivia, both having successful careers in wrestling. This upbringing had a profound influence on his future career.

After playing college football at the University of Miami, Johnson faced challenges in pursuing a professional football career. He eventually turned to wrestling, adopting the persona of "Rocky Maivia," which later evolved into "The Rock." His charisma and in-ring abilities quickly made him a fan favorite in the WWE.

Overview of "Ballers"

"Ballers" premiered on HBO in 2015 and is a comedy-drama series that follows a group of former and current football players as they navigate their lives in Miami. Dwayne Johnson plays the lead role of Spencer Strasmore, a retired NFL player turned financial manager.

The show explores themes of friendship, wealth, and the challenges athletes face after their careers end. It provides a unique perspective on the sports industry and the personal lives of its players.

Character Analysis: Spencer Strasmore

Spencer Strasmore is a complex character who embodies the struggles and triumphs of a retired athlete. His journey reflects the reality many athletes face as they transition into new careers.

  • Background: Former NFL player
  • Career Transition: Becomes a financial advisor
  • Character Traits: Charismatic, ambitious, and at times, conflicted
